Tangail: A mobile court today sentenced two individuals to imprisonment over drug offenses in Bhuyapur upazila of the district. The court, led by acting Upazila Nirbahi Officer (UNO) and Assistant Commissioner (Land) Md Rajib Hossain, took action following reports of narcotics being sold clandestinely under the guise of business activities.



According to Bangladesh Sangbad Sangstha, Md Abdul Malek, 40, of Balkutia village, was handed a two-year jail term and fined Taka 5,500 for drug peddling. In a separate case, Shukkur, 27, of Kostapara village, received six months’ imprisonment and a Taka 500 fine for drug abuse.



The UNO stated that such drives will continue to ensure public safety in the area.
